Bare Metal Server
- 印刷する
- PDF
Bare Metal Server
- 印刷する
- PDF
記事の要約
この要約は役に立ちましたか?
ご意見ありがとうございます
Classic/VPC環境で利用できます。
VPC環境の Bare Metalサーバインスタンス(VM)リストを照会し、サーバ別 Cloud Log Analyticsサービスを利用したログ収集の設定状態を確認します。
リクエスト
リクエスト形式を説明します。リクエスト形式は次の通りです。
メソッド | URI |
---|---|
GET | /api/{regionCode}-v1/vpc/servers/baremetal |
リクエストヘッダ
Cloud Log Analytics APIで共通して使用されるヘッダの詳細は、Cloud Log Analyticsのリクエストヘッダをご参照ください。
リクエストパスパラメータ
リクエストパスパラメータの説明は次の通りです。
フィールド | タイプ | 必須の有無 | 説明 |
---|---|---|---|
regionCode | String | Required | リージョンコード
|
リクエストクエリパラメータ
リクエストパスパラメータの説明は次の通りです。
フィールド | タイプ | 必須の有無 | 説明 |
---|---|---|---|
pageNo | Integer | Optional | ページ番号
|
pageSize | Integer | Optional | ページごとの項目数
|
リクエスト例
リクエストのサンプルコードは次の通りです。
curl --location --request GET 'https://cloudloganalytics.apigw.ntruss.com/api/{regionCode}-v1/vpc/servers/baremetal' \
--header 'x-ncp-apigw-timestamp: {Timestamp}' \
--header 'x-ncp-iam-access-key: {Access Key}' \
--header 'x-ncp-apigw-signature-v2: {API Gateway Signature}' \
--header 'Content-Type: application/json' \
レスポンス
レスポンス形式を説明します。
レスポンスボディ
レスポンスボディの説明は次の通りです。
フィールド | タイプ | 必須の有無 | 説明 |
---|---|---|---|
code | Integer | - | レスポンスステータスコード |
message | String | - | レスポンスステータスメッセージ |
result | Object | - | レスポンス結果 |
result.pageSize | Integer | - | ページごとの項目数 |
result.currentPage | Integer | - | 現在のページ番号 |
result.totalPage | Integer | - | ページの総数 |
result.totalCount | Integer | - | 総項目数 |
result.isPaged | Boolean | - | ページングするかどうか
|
result.vpcServerInfos | Array | - | サーバリスト
|
result.collectingCount | Integer | - | ログ収集設定完了サーバ数 |
vpcServerInfos
vpcServerInfos
の説明は次の通りです。
フィールド | タイプ | 必須の有無 | 説明 |
---|---|---|---|
additionalParameterMap | Object | - | サーバ情報 |
collectingInfo | Object | - | ログ収集設定情報 |
collectingInfo.collectorAgentVersion | String | - | ログ収集エージェントのバージョン |
collectingInfo.logTypeCount | Integer | - | 収集対象ログのタイプ数 |
collectingInfo.collectionStatus | String | - | ログ収集状態 |
collectingInfo.settingStatus | String | - | ログ収集の設定状態 |
collectingInfo.settingStatusColor | String | - | ログ収集設定状態の色表記 |
collectingInfo.servername | String | - | ログ収集対象のサーバ名 |
collectingInfo.logCollectorDate | String | - | ログ収集の設定日時 |
collectingInfo.logTypeList | String | - | 収集対象ログのタイプリスト |
collectingInfo.configKey | String | - | ログ収集エージェントの Install Key |
collectingInfo.isCollecting | Boolean | - | ログ収集を有効化するかどうか
|
参考
Server情報関連フィールド(additionalParameterMap
)の詳細は、Server APIガイドとServerご利用ガイドをご参照ください。
レスポンスステータスコード
Cloud Log Analytics APIで共通して使用されるレスポンスステータスコードの詳細は、Cloud Log Analyticsのレスポンスステータスコードをご参照ください。
レスポンス例
レスポンスのサンプルコードは次の通りです。
{
"code": 0,
"message": "リクエストが正常に処理されました。",
"result": {
"pageSize": 10,
"currentPage": 1,
"totalPage": 1,
"totalCount": 1,
"isPaged": true,
"vpcServerInfos": [
{
"additionalParameterMap": {
"networkInterfaceList": [
{
"vpcNo": 77778,
"vpcName": "test",
"subnetNo": 177781,
"subnetName": "mgmt-subnet",
"subnet": "***.***.***.***/**",
"igwYn": "Y",
"zoneNo": 2,
"zoneName": "KR-1",
"networkInterfaceNo": 4352109,
"networkInterfaceName": "nic-4352109",
"internalIp": "***.***.***.***",
"macAddress": "**:**:**:**:**:**",
"attachedDeviceName": "eth0",
"secondaryIps": [
null
]
}
],
"igwYn": "Y",
"vpcName": "test",
"vpcNo": 77778,
"subnetName": "mgmt-subnet",
"subnetNo": 177781
},
"baseBlockStorageSize": null,
"carrierNetworkIp": "***.***.***.***",
"computeInstanceDetailTypeCode": null,
"computeInstanceName": "s19293f45ef5",
"computeInstanceTypeCode": "VSVR",
"computeInstanceUuid": null,
"computeSpec": "vCPU 2EA, Memory 8GB, Disk 50GB",
"contractNo": 17792786,
"cpuCount": 2,
"createYmdt": 1729059121967,
"hostNameInitConfigYn": null,
"instanceNo": 27057139,
"instanceProductType2Code": "STAND",
"instanceStatusCode": "RUN",
"instanceStatusName": "running",
"instanceTypeCode": "VSVR",
"ip": null,
"launchDateTime": 1729059320699,
"macAddress": null,
"nsiName": "centos-7.3-64",
"operationCode": "NULL",
"operationYmdt": "1729059320699",
"osDiskTypeCode": "NET",
"osDiskTypeDetailCode": "HDD",
"osInformation": "CentOS 7.3 (64-bit)",
"osName": "CentOS 7.3 (64-bit)",
"overlayNetworkIp": "172.16.1.7",
"parameters": null,
"platformTypeCode": "LNX64",
"productCode": "SVR.VSVR.STAND.C002.M008.NET.bareMetal.B050.G002",
"publicIp": null,
"publicIpInstanceNo": null,
"regionCode": "KR",
"regionName": "Korea",
"serverName": "s19293f45ef5",
"serverSpec": "vCPU 2EA, Memory 8GB, Disk 50GB",
"softwareProductCode": "SW.VSVR.OS.LNX64.CNTOS.0703.B050",
"subnetName": null,
"subAccountNo": null,
"upTime": null,
"vpcName": null,
"zoneName": "KR-1",
"zoneNo": 2,
"serverStatusColor": "green",
"serverStatusKorean": "実行中",
"serverStatusValue": "実行中",
"isSupportOS": true,
"collectingInfo": {
"collectorAgentVersion": "7.17.2",
"logTypeCount": 5,
"collectionStatus": "未設定",
"settingStatus": "設定完了",
"settingStatusColor": "green",
"servername": "s19293f45ef5",
"logCollectorDate": "2024-11-08 22:30:57",
"logTypeList": "tomcat_catalina,SYSLOG,security_log,apache_access,apache_error",
"configKey": "***********",
"isCollecting": true
}
}
],
"collectingCount": 1
}
}
この記事は役に立ちましたか?